IHG One Rewards Premier Credit Card

IHG One Rewards Premier Credit Card image

Learn How to Apply

Earn 170,000 Bonus Points after spending $4,000 on purchases in the first 3 months from account opening.

IHG One Rewards Premier Credit Card has an increased welcome offer now of 170,000 IHG rewards after a minimum spend of $4,000 in 3 months.

The IHG card confuses a lot of people because you have probably never seen an “IHG Hotel” along the side of the road. IHG hotels include Intercontinental, Holiday Inn, Crowne Plaza, Candlewood Suites, and more. There are more than 5,000 of them to choose from worldwide.

Many IHG properties go for as little as 10,000 points per night, with their high end properties pricing out around 80,000 points per night.

Kimpton Seafire and Kimpton Grand Roatan are great redemptions for this card!

Capital One Spark Cash Plus

Capital One Spark Cash Plus image

Learn How To Apply

$2,000 Cash Back once you spend $30,000 in the first 3 months. Earn an additional $2,000 cash bonus for every $500K spent during the first year.

This card has piqued our interest lately! You’ll earn $2,000 cash back after a $30K spend in 3 months.  It has a HUGE spend to meet the sign up bonus, but if you have a large expense coming up, I'm looking at you taxes, this is a great option to make that spend work for you.

If you have a Capital One Venture Rewards Credit Card or Capital One Venture X Credit Card, this card’s welcome offer can be converted from $2,000 cash back to 200,000 Capital One Venture Miles, which is what we’ll be doing.  And another plus: it won’t count towards your 5/24 status.

The Business Platinum Card® from American Express

This welcome offer can be found for up to 250,000 American Express Membership Rewards® online after spending $20,000 in the first three months. The standard offer is currently 150,000 Membership Rewards® points. Again, not everyone can meet that kind of minimum spend, but if you can, it is an amazing deal!

Amex Business Platinum cardholders also get complimentary access to the Amex Centurion Lounges, which are some of the best airport lounges in the US. Along with Access to the Global Lounge Collection, allowing you to access 1,300+ airport lounges worldwide. Enrollment required.

Cardholders also receive Gold status with Marriott and Hilton (enrollment required).
